Discover the unique and remarkable character of the place and reveal its minerals. The quarries were dug out over the years to extract the limestone.
Masterpieces are projected onto the huge walls, pillars and floors of the quarry. They transport you to colourful worlds with music. Over a hundred video projectors project images onto more than 7,000 m² of floor space.
Each year, Carrières des Lumières offers you an extraordinary experience by immersing you in the work of great figures in modern and contemporary painting.
A unique place, a magical atmosphere and a wealth of masterpieces!

The Egypt of the Pharaohs, from Cheops to Ramses II
Step back in time and rediscover the Egypt of the pharaohs through the masterpieces of this mythical civilisation that spanned three millennia.
From the genesis of ancient Egypt to the mythical battles that punctuated the lives of the great rulers, visitors are invited to travel up the Nile to discover the wealth, genius and wisdom of a civilisation that still fascinates us today.
In the light of this immersive exhibition, the Pharaohs become giants and their tombs are erected before our very eyes, for a fabulous journey.

The Orientalists, Ingres, Delacroix, Gérôme…
In the 19th century, the gates of the Orient opened for Western painters drawn by the mysteries of faraway lands. Dazzled by the light of the Deep South, revealing the relief of arid landscapes and the colours of spectacularly patterned architecture, the Orientalists Delacroix, Gérôme, Ingres and other major names in European expression were captivated by these discoveries.
The Carrières des Lumières invite visitors on a pictorial expedition to the exotic and bewitching new world of the Orient these artists dreamt of.
